Output 66adb300a0212f97b75fe3e530877be4f35e7fd5408d7d7d0ead9665983c5d02:0

value
24949970
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9be83489091c71cc0d97d2d247f2e0cee97738ca OP_EQUALVERIFY OP_CHECKSIG
address
1FDMudq334WvrZH1Xa6GzYGTRT3aEsBRh6
transaction
66adb300a0212f97b75fe3e530877be4f35e7fd5408d7d7d0ead9665983c5d02
spent
true